Is it obligatory to perform a full-body ghusl if a slight trace of feces is found on clothing after waking up, given that its excretion was not felt, and is repeating the 'Isha and Fajr prayers valid?
Source: FtawySummarized from the full answer at Ftawy · imported Sep 2, 2026
A full body ablution () is not required for passing stool. If it is suspected that stool was passed either before or after the prayer, its expulsion is presumed to have occurred after the prayer, and thus the prayer is valid and does not need to be repeated. If the impure area is washed and the prayer is repeated, one has fulfilled their obligation. However, if there was residual impurity from a previous purification, the prayer is valid and does not need to be repeated.
